What languages does Blackboard support?

The following languages are currently available: Arabic, Chinese (Simplified), Chinese (Traditional), Czech, Danish, Dutch, English (United Kingdom), English (United States), Finnish, French, German, Italian, Japanese, Korean, Malay, Norwegian, Polish, Portuguese, Russian, Swedish, Spanish, Thai, Turkish, and Welsh.

Why is my blackboard in another language?

You can see Blackboard Learn in different languages and cultural norms by changing the language pack. Language packs are set at the system level, the course level, and the user level. ... Your language pack preference overrides the course language pack when the course language pack in not enforced.Jun 18, 2013

How do I make blackboard English?

At this time, instructors can't change language packs at the course level in the Ultra experience....To change the language at a user level:Select Language on your profile.Select a language pack from the menu.Select Submit.

What is a language pack?

Language packs are sets of text files and images that are used to display Blackboard Learn in a specific language. Language packs are composed of two components: user interface (UI) text and help.

Can you make content unavailable to students?

Yes. As you create content, you can set its availability. You can make content unavailable to students until you're ready for them to view it. You can also limit which content items students see based on date, time, individual users, course groups, and their performance on graded items.

Can you set a language pack in an original environment?

In an Original environment, you can set a language pack that is different from the default to make all users in a course view the same language pack. For example, if you teach a Spanish language class, you may want to select Spanish for the course-level language.

What is the default screen in Blackboard Learn?

After you log in, the default intial screen is the activity stream. If your institution is able to set a landing page for Blackboard Learn, such as the course list, the app matches that setting. If the landing page is set to the institution page, the activity stream shows instead because institution pages aren't available in the app.
